Merge pull request #12393 from fosterseth/subsystem_metrics_delete_redis_keys

Subsystem metrics reset_values should remove all redis keys
This commit is contained in:
Seth Foster 2022-06-22 11:34:20 -04:00 committed by GitHub
commit 9419270897
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-213,6 +213,8 @@ class Metrics:
m.reset_value(self.conn)
self.metrics_have_changed = True
self.conn.delete(root_key + "_lock")
for m in self.conn.scan_iter(root_key + '_instance_*'):
self.conn.delete(m)
def inc(self, field, value):
if value != 0: